The so-called agreement refers to the amount of betrothal gifts and dowry agreed upon by both parties in the marriage. In order to prevent property disputes after marriage, a contract is necessary and the promises of both parties are written on the contract. This is called "If you want to marry a wife, ask how much money you are for; if you want to marry a daughter, ask how much money you are for hiring a daughter", which is the most basic marriage custom at that time.

After the "Agreement" is over, it means that the marriage has been agreed upon, and the following is the "give gift" to the "give gift". After the money gift, the man and the woman exchanged the Geng letter, which means that the marriage has completely become a "conclusive". Then both the man and the woman have to give all of it.
In the Song Dynasty, rich families gave gifts to "three golds" as fashionable. That is, gold bracelets, gold-headed faces, and golden cloaks. Families who could not afford goldware were replaced by "silver plated". This kind of wealth betrothal gift mainly consisted of gold shining with a good atmosphere of wealth. This kind of marriage betrothal gift was never seen in the Tang Dynasty's marriage betrothal gifts, and it was not achieved after the Yuan Dynasty. It reflects the indisputable dominance of commodity currency economy in urban marriages in the Song Dynasty.

In order to prevent men and women from marrying because they cannot afford betrothal gifts and wealth gifts, the Song Dynasty government specially established the title of hiring wealth. The Song Dynasty stipulated that men's families were mainly divided into upper, middle and lower three grades: "One tael of gold in the upper household, five taels of silver in the upper household, six inside and six inside, and forty pieces of silk in the mixed use; five coins in the middle household, four taels of silver in the middle household, four taels of silver in the middle, and thirty pieces of silk in the mixed use; three taels of silver in the lower household, three taels of silver in the color in the inner household, and fifteen pieces of silk in the mixed use."
